About Hawk Island Lighthouse
Also known as: Poulaman
This skeletal steel tower, standing 10 meters tall, is painted with red and white horizontal bands. Its design features a triangular skeletal structure with an enclosed lower section that supports a daymark. The focal height of the light is 13 meters above sea level. From its position on Hawk Island, the lighthouse emits a green flash every four seconds, visible for up to 11.3 nautical miles. It aids navigation in the coastal waters near Poulamon, Nova Scotia.
